狀態機圖表製作一站到位
專為建模「狀態、轉換與系統行為」而設計的精準控制工具
多種狀態類型
從一般(Simple)、複合(Composite)、起始(Start)、結束(End)、選擇(Choice)、分叉(Fork)與匯合(Join)等狀態中自由挑選,精準描繪任何有限狀態機(Finite State Machine)。
帶標籤的轉換箭頭
在每一條轉換箭頭上附加條件、事件或動作標籤,讓你的流程圖清楚傳達系統的實際邏輯與判斷依據。
AI 智能自動生成
只要用自然語言描述你的系統需求,MakeCharts 的 AI 就能自動產生完整的有限狀態機圖:把狀態與轉換關係一次對應整理好。
方向式版面配置
支援由上到下或由左到右的版面切換,讓你的圖更貼合結構,閱讀順暢、脈絡一目了然。
狀態內嵌註記
可為任何狀態直接附上註解(支援置於左側或右側),用來補充假設、限制條件或實作細節,讓文件更好維護。
主題樣式自訂
一鍵套用 Default、Forest、Dark、Neutral 等配色主題,輕鬆符合品牌風格或文件版面需求。
用你最順手的方式建立狀態機
直接輸入
在視覺化編輯器中手動新增狀態與轉移,完全不需要語法或程式碼。
用 AI 描述
告訴 MakeCharts 你要建模的系統,AI 會在一步內直接生成完成的有限狀態機圖。
從文件貼上
把狀態清單與轉移規則從任何文件複製貼上,編輯器會立即幫你自動對應並完成繪圖。
上傳資料檔
匯入包含狀態與轉移資料的 CSV 或試算表,讓圖表自動生成(Pro)。
隨時分享與匯出
下載為 PNG 或 SVG
將狀態機圖表以清晰、高解析度匯出,方便用於文件、簡報與報告。
透過連結分享
複製圖表的直連網址,立即與團隊、審閱者或客戶分享。
嵌入到你的網站
貼上輕量的嵌入程式碼,將狀態圖加入任何網頁或 wiki(Plus 及以上)。
即刻上台呈現
輸出內容乾淨、標示清楚,讓你的圖表在任何簡報或技術文件中都看起來更專業。
關於 MakeCharts 狀態機圖工具
MakeCharts 是一款免費的線上圖表製作工具,主打快速與清晰。它的狀態機圖製作器讓任何人──開發者、設計師或分析師──都能不必和複雜的繪圖軟體搏鬥,就能把系統行為建模起來。只要描述你的狀態、串接狀態間的轉移,幾分鐘內就能輸出一張精緻的有限狀態機(Finite State Machine)圖。
- ✓為狀態圖量身打造:提供 7 種狀態類型選項
- ✓支援以自然文字進行 AI 生成,想法更快變成圖
- ✓新增與編輯狀態時即時預覽效果
- ✓多種配色主題與版面方向可選
- ✓可匯出 PNG 或 SVG,滿足各種使用情境
- ✓免費開始使用:免安裝、免註冊
數字看成效
如何製作狀態機圖
用 3 個步驟,從想法到完成清楚、可分享的有限狀態機圖
定義你的狀態
把系統可能出現的每個狀態都新增進來。為每個狀態指定類型(起始、結束、單一、選擇、或複合),並可視需要補上一段簡短說明,讓圖更好理解。
狀態:閒置(起始)、處理中(簡單)、成功(結束)、錯誤(結束)
新增轉移(流程箭頭)
用「標註過的轉移」把狀態彼此連起來。每一條箭頭都代表某個事件或條件發生後,系統會從一個狀態切換到另一個狀態。
轉移:處理中 → 成功,標籤:'已收到回應'
自訂排版並匯出
調整版面方向、配色主題、字體大小,必要時也可以加註解/備註。完成後即可下載你的狀態機圖(例如 SVG),或直接分享連結給其他人。
主題:深色、方向:由左到右、匯出為 SVG
狀態機圖製作工具是給誰用的?
從軟體工程到商務流程設計——用狀態圖把系統行為講清楚、畫明白
定義模型的應用狀態與邏輯
軟體工程師會用有限狀態機(Finite State Machine)圖,先把 UI 流程、通訊協定處理器以及後端狀態機的轉換規則設計好,甚至在寫第一行程式之前就把行為規格釐清。
繪製畫面狀態與互動流程
產品設計師用狀態圖把每個畫面狀態與切換條件完整記錄下來,讓交接工程師時更精準,降低來回溝通成本與理解落差。
文件化流程與工作流邏輯
商業分析師會把訂單管理、審核工作流、客服工單生命週期建模成狀態機圖,對齊所有利害關係人對流程規則的正確理解,確保每個轉換條件都有依據。
設計裝置與硬體的狀態行為
嵌入式工程師使用有限狀態機圖來定義裝置模式、電源狀態以及感測器反應邏輯,先把行為規格規劃到位,再進入實作流程。
AI 狀態機圖製作工具:MakeCharts
看看為什麼團隊會從 Visio、draw.io 轉用 MakeCharts 來製作狀態機圖
傳統繪圖工具
- ✗每個狀態與箭頭都要手動拖拉繪製
- ✗不理解狀態機語意,只能靠你自己維持正確性
- ✗重排或改版往往會把版面搞亂,還會浪費大量時間
- ✗分享通常不方便:常需匯出檔案或另外安裝軟體
- ✗沒有 AI 協助——所有思考與調整都得靠人工
- ✗對新手來說學習曲線偏陡
MakeCharts 狀態機圖製作器
- ✓只要用文字描述,你就能快速生成有限狀態機(FSM)圖
- ✓提供專屬狀態類型:開始(start)、結束(end)、選擇(choice)、分流(fork)、匯流(join)、複合(composite)
- ✓版面配置可即時切換:由上到下或由左到右
- ✓透過連結分享或直接嵌入——不需要上傳或附加檔案
- ✓用自然語言微調標籤、狀態與轉移流程
- ✓直接在瀏覽器運作——不用安裝任何程式
常見問答(FAQ)
什麼是狀態機圖(State Machine Diagram)製作工具?
狀態機圖製作工具是一種線上工具,讓你可以用視覺化方式建立「有限狀態機(FSM, Finite State Machine)」圖。你先定義「狀態」(系統可能處於的條件),再定義「轉移」(觸發事件後從一個狀態移到另一個狀態)。MakeCharts 提供直覺的視覺編輯器與 AI 生成功能,讓整個製作流程更快、更好上手。
怎麼用免費方式做出有限狀態機圖(FSM diagram)?
打開 MakeCharts,選擇「State Diagram(狀態圖)」的圖表類型。你可以直接把系統描述交給 AI 生成;或在設定面板中手動新增狀態與轉移。開始使用不需要帳號。免費用戶可完整使用視覺編輯器,並且可以匯出 PNG 圖片。
狀態圖(State Diagram)跟有限狀態機圖(FSM diagram)有什麼差別?
這兩個名詞常被混用。有限狀態機(FSM)圖是一種正式模型,且狀態數是固定、清楚可辨的;狀態圖(State Diagram)則是把這個模型用「視覺化圖表」呈現出來的表示方式。MakeCharts 同時支援簡單 FSM,以及更具表達力的 UML-style 狀態圖,包含複合狀態(Composite states)、分流/匯流點(Fork/Join points)與選擇節點(Choice nodes)。
我可以用 AI 自動生成狀態機圖嗎?
可以。你只要在 AI 提示中輸入描述,例如「order processing: pending, processing, shipped, delivered, cancelled」,MakeCharts 就能生成完整的狀態機圖(包含轉移與標籤)。接著你也能在視覺編輯器中自由修改任何狀態或轉移內容。
狀態圖製作工具支援哪些狀態類型?
MakeCharts 支援七種狀態類型:Simple State(簡單狀態)、Composite State(複合狀態)、Start State(起始狀態)、End State(結束狀態)、Choice Point(選擇點)、Fork Point(分流點)、Join Point(匯流點)。這能涵蓋 UML statechart 常見的完整記法,從簡單流程到複雜的並行系統建模都能用。
為每個人打造
- ✓不需要繪圖經驗 — 編輯器一步步帶你完成
- ✓支援瀏覽器直接使用,桌機或手機都能用
- ✓提供 12+ 種語言,方便全球團隊協作
- ✓免費方案免註冊 — 立刻開始使用
- ✓操作簡單好上手,同時也足夠工程師使用
- ✓提供 AI 協助,不論技能高低都能更快完成
你的圖表,你的資料
- •你的圖表資料只用於用來產生、渲染並匯出你的圖表
- •我們不會出售或向第三方提供你的資料
- •你可以自行控制分享內容 — 圖表預設為私人,不公開
- •你可以隨時刪除帳號與相關資料
- •不會為了廣告目的追蹤圖表內容
立刻建立你的狀態機圖
免費、快速、免安裝。把系統行為用幾分鐘就能建模完成。